Transaction 066d6e0587787a2c7a093b890512a75157ab61d45b383fff52bd012631664b95
1 Input
1 Output
-
066d6e0587787a2c7a093b890512a75157ab61d45b383fff52bd012631664b95:0
- value
- 90529
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ab42c174b770d9f41cb19d3035e556920dbecb84 OP_EQUAL
- address
- 3HJZScX7bqfDzEeqxsMHYo8XyiJw41UUGR